What should I know about the stability and load capacity of a camping snack shelf table, and how do materials affect it?

Stability and load capacity depend on the frame design and the material used. Metal frames and solid tops provide higher rigidity and better weight tolerance, ideal for larger snack setups or cooking gear. Wood frames offer a rustic look and good strength but can warp if exposed to moisture, while bamboo-based trays are lightweight and portable but typically support lighter loads. Look for features like cross-bracing, secure legs, and non-slip feet to keep the table steady on uneven ground.

How do I set up and maintain a camping snack shelf table to keep snacks organized and safe?

Set up on a flat, stable surface and ensure legs are locked or folded securely before use. Use a non-slip mat or feet to prevent sliding on dirt, sand, or grass. Clean according to material: stainless steel and metal surfaces with mild soap and water; wood-stainless-steel combos and bamboo trays should be wiped dry and avoid soaking. Store the table in a dry, shaded spot when not in use to prevent moisture damage.

What common mistakes should I avoid when selecting a camping snack shelf table?

Avoid choosing a table that is too bulky for your tent or camp setup or one that is too light for heavy snacks and dishes. Don’t ignore the importance of foldability, portability, and weather resistance, especially for outdoor use. Don’t overlook cleaning and maintenance needs; different materials require different care to last. Finally, ensure the table you pick can integrate with your existing camp gear and offers practical storage options for snacks and utensils.
